mirror of
https://github.com/bitwarden/browser
synced 2026-02-10 05:30:01 +00:00
Use sdk directly to get algorithm
This commit is contained in:
@@ -8,7 +8,7 @@ export class PublicAccountKeysResponseModel {
|
||||
readonly SignedPublicKeyOwnershipClaim: SignedPublicKeyOwnershipClaim;
|
||||
|
||||
constructor(response: any) {
|
||||
this.VerifyingKey = new VerifyingKey(response.verifyingKey, response.verifyingKeyAlgorithm);
|
||||
this.VerifyingKey = new VerifyingKey(response.verifyingKey);
|
||||
this.PublicKey = response.publicKey;
|
||||
this.SignedPublicKeyOwnershipClaim = response.signedPublicKeyOwnershipClaim;
|
||||
}
|
||||
|
||||
@@ -1,9 +1,4 @@
|
||||
import {
|
||||
parseSigningKeyTypeFromString,
|
||||
SigningKeyType,
|
||||
UserSigningKey,
|
||||
VerifyingKey,
|
||||
} from "@bitwarden/key-management";
|
||||
import { SigningKeyType, UserSigningKey, VerifyingKey } from "@bitwarden/key-management";
|
||||
|
||||
export class UserSigningKeyData {
|
||||
readonly keyAlgorithm: SigningKeyType;
|
||||
@@ -13,9 +8,6 @@ export class UserSigningKeyData {
|
||||
constructor(response: any) {
|
||||
this.keyAlgorithm = response.keyAlgorithm;
|
||||
this.wrappedSigningKey = new UserSigningKey(response.wrappedSigningKey);
|
||||
this.verifyingKey = new VerifyingKey(
|
||||
response.verifyingKey,
|
||||
parseSigningKeyTypeFromString(this.keyAlgorithm),
|
||||
);
|
||||
this.verifyingKey = new VerifyingKey(response.verifyingKey);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user